Ingredients
- NGREDIENTS:
- 2 (16 ounce) cans beets
- 1 cup white vinegar
- 1-1/2 cups white sugar
- 2 tablespoons cornstarch
- salt to taste

Preparation
Step 1
DIRECTIONS:
You have scaled this recipe's ingredients to yield a new amount (6). The directions below still refer to the original recipe yield (3).
1. Drain the beet liquid into a medium saucepan. To the liquid add vinegar, sugar, cornstarch and salt.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at. Reduce heat to medium; stir in beets and cook until heated through.
